Where is Rosa Blanca brewed?
Rosa Blanca is imported from Spain, but the UK version is weaker: 3.4% against 4.8% at home.
In short
Rosa Blanca is imported. The UK product is brewed at Barcelona in Spain. It is, however, a weaker version: 3.4% here against 4.8% at home. That puts it a tenth of a percent under the 3.5% threshold at which UK alcohol duty drops sharply. The brand belongs to S.A. Damm, which also owns Damm and Estrella Damm in the UK. The label says: "Country of origin: Spain. Brewed by: C.C. Damm S.L., Rossello 515, 08025 Barcelona, Spain. Damm 1876 Ltd., 5A Bear Lane, SE1 0UH, London."
Who has brewed it here
| Years | Brewer | Site | Source |
|---|---|---|---|
| 2018 to now | None (imported from Damm, Barcelona) | Barcelona, Spain | tesco.com |
